Description

*Description*:
Currently, Envoy Gateway supports two levels of backend priorities: active and passive. While this is sufficient for basic use cases, it limits more advanced traffic management scenarios for GenAI traffic where multiple levels of backend priorities are required for multiple regions, model providers, on-demand and provisioned throughput with different context length.

For multi-region deployment, we want to prioritize backends in following orders to achieve higher SLO target.
- us-east-1
- us-east-2
- us-west-2

For on-demand, provisioned throughput deployment, we want to prioritize backends in following orders based on the capacity.
- PT with small context length
- PT with large context length
- on-demand endpoint

Extend the envoy gateway configuration to support multiple backend priority levels which can be achieved by introducing the priority field in the backend configuration, allowing users to specify a numerical priority level.
